A destination wedding in Halkidiki fuses laid-back Mediterranean elegance with the region’s pine-lined coastlines and sapphire waters, delivering an unforgettable backdrop for couples ready to say “I do” in style. Celebrated for its golden beaches, picturesque fishing villages, and five-star resorts, Halkidiki sets the stage for a celebration that balances romance and refined luxury. Whether you dream of a toes-in-the-sand ceremony on Kassandra’s sun-kissed shores or a lavish reception at a cliff-top villa overlooking the Aegean, Halkidiki offers boundless ways to craft a day as unique as your love story.

Additional Information

Getting to Halkidiki is refreshingly simple. The peninsula itself has no commercial airport, but Thessaloniki International Airport “Makedonia” (SKG) sits just 45 – 75 minutes away by road, depending on whether your venue is in Kassandra, Sithonia or the Athos coast. SKG receives direct seasonal flights from more than 40 major European cities plus year-round connections from Athens and other Greek hubs. A private transfer or taxi covers the SKG-to-Halkidiki run in about an hour, making arrival effortless for international guests welcomepickups.com. Budget-minded travellers can connect via the KTEL Chalkidikis intercity bus network: buses leave the dedicated Halkidiki bus station in eastern Thessaloniki almost hourly, linking the airport area and the region’s resort towns. Once in Halkidiki, most couples choose rental cars or pre-booked minibuses for wedding-day logistics, while taxis and local boat taxis shuttle guests between beaches and marinas. The road system hugs the coast, so even the furthest venues rarely exceed a scenic 60-90-minute drive from one “finger” to the next. Halkidiki enjoys a classic Mediterranean climate, with warm, dry summers and mild springs and autumns. The prime wedding window runs May through September, when daytime highs average 24 – 30 °C and rainfall is minimal whitestories.gr. July–August deliver cloud-free skies but can feel hot in formalwear, so many planners steer ceremonies to late May–June or early-to-mid September for perfect light, gentler heat and thinner crowds theweddingtravelcompany.com. Shoulder months (April and October) still see plenty of sunshine and offer lower venue rates—ideal for elopements or smaller celebrations. Unlike island destinations, Halkidiki requires no ferries. All three peninsulas radiate from a single highway network, so venues, hotels and photo spots are rarely more than a short convoy apart. That compactness keeps rehearsal dinners, beach parties and day-after brunches logistically painless for you and your guests.

Just the Two of You

Elope in Halkidiki

A Halkidiki elopement offers the perfect blend of convenience and natural beauty. With no ferry required and easy access from Thessaloniki, you can enjoy a stress-free intimate ceremony on some of Greece's most stunning beaches.

Halkidiki elopements typically cost between €3,000–€6,500 and include a ceremony venue, officiant, photographer, and celebratory dinner. The region's three peninsulas offer diverse settings—from secluded Sithonia coves to luxury Kassandra resorts.

Popular elopement locations include the turquoise waters of Kavourotrypes (Orange Beach), private beach settings at Sani, and scenic spots along Sithonia's coastline. Whether you prefer barefoot simplicity or resort elegance, eloping in Halkidiki combines accessibility with Mediterranean charm.
